19 – Omega and the End of the Universe

19 – Omega and the End of the Universe

Class begins with a review of the issues previously addressed about the origin and fate of the universe. The role of gravity in the expansion of the universe is discussed and given as the reason why the rate of expansion cannot remain constant and will eventually slow down. The actual density of the universe is calculated using various methods. Finally, the unsolved problem of dark matter is addressed and two explanatory hypotheses are proposed. One is that the universe is comprised of WIMPs (Weakly Interactive Massive Particles) that fulfill two requirements: they have mass and do not interact with light. The second hypothesis is that dark matter is made of MACHOs (Massive Astrophysical Compact Halo Objects), which scientists have attempted to identify through gravitational lenses.

18 – Hubble’s Law and the Big Bang pt 3

18 – Hubble’s Law and the Big Bang pt 3

Professor Bailyn returns to the subject of the expansion of the universe to offer explanations that do not require belief in the Big Bang theory. One alternative is a theory that, in the past, the entire universe was reduced to an “initial singularity,” in which everything was much closer, and therefore denser and hotter. Since the universe is in constant flux, however, it follows that in the future things will drift apart. The Steady State explanation for the expansion of the universe is then explained. Coined as a derogatory term meant to ridicule supporters of the Big Bang theory, Steady State purports that new energy and matter are constantly created as the universe expands, to fill in the void that results from the expansion. The discovery of quasars refuted the Steady State theory. The lecture ends with a discussion of how observing very distant objects allows us to look back in time, and also gives us a glimpse into the future of galaxies and the universe.

20 – The Value of Life, Part II; Other Bad Aspects of Death, Part I

20 – The Value of Life, Part II; Other Bad Aspects of Death, Part I

Lecture 20 continues the discussion of the value of life. It considers the neutral container theory, which holds that the value of life is simply a function of its contents, both pleasant and painful, and contrasts this with the valuable container theory, which assigns value to being alive itself. The lecture then turns to a consideration of some of the other aspects of death that may contribute to the badness of death. Among the issues addressed are the inevitability, variability and unpredictability of death.
